Research Results

In 2005, the author conducted research on the sexual behavior of adolescent high school in Surakarta. The subject of this study amounted to 1250 persons, derived from 10 high school in Surakarta, which consisted of 611 male subjects and 639 female subjects.

Most subjects had used the media of pornography, the male subjects as many as 497 people (81.34%) and 181 female subjects (28.32%); subjects who claimed never to use the media of pornography on male subjects as many as 114 people ( 18.66%), female subjects 458 individuals (71.67%). Most of the subjects said they had watched pornographic movies, the male subjects as many as 403 people (28.54%) and 111 female subjects (34.91%), a small portion of pornography through the photos on male subjects 135 people (9, 56%) and female subjects 22 people (6.92%).

Some subjects 212 were male (34.69%) admitted that sometimes doing masturbation, female subjects 27 people (4.23%), and 77 people (12.60%) male subjects and 9 people (1, 41%) women admitted until now still active in masturbation.

Most of the subjects claimed to have been dating. Age of first dating mostly 15-17 years male subjects as many as 246 people (53.25%) and 272 female subjects (57.99%), aged 20-22 years by 1 person (0.22%) on the subject of women was not found. Most of the subjects claimed to have changed a girlfriend for 1-2 times, namely on the subject of male-lakisebanyak 194 people (41.99%) and in female subjects as many as 196 people (41.79%). Most of the subjects admitted undergo courtship activity 2 - 6 months, namely the male subjects 171 (37.01%) in female subjects as many as 153 people (32.62%), on the subject of male courtship activity less than 1 month as many as 81 people (17.53 %) in female subjects as many as 67 people (14.28%). Courtship activity subject mostly done at home itself is in the male subjects 164 people (23.33%), on the subject of women as much as 37 people (5.23%).

Subjects who had sexual intercourse of 462 male subjects of dating found in 139 people (30.09%), who claimed to have had sexual intercourse than women who are dating 469 subjects found 25 people (5.33%). The reason they have sex as a proof of love in the male subjects of 57 people (38.51%), whereas in female subjects 6 people (24%); by reason of being raped or forced the male subjects 4 people (2.70 %) in female subjects 2 people (8%).

Age of the subject was first sexual intercourse is 15-17 years which is in men by 60 people (43.16%) in female subjects 12 people (48%). Sexual intercourse is mostly conducted along with her boyfriend, the male subjects 105 (53.29%) while in female subjects 21 people (84%).

After having sexual relations most subjects were satisfied or pleasure, the male subjects 61 people (43.88%), whereas in female subjects of 3 people (12%). Most subjects believe sexual intercourse is sinful: in male subjects 329 individuals (34.52%), whereas in female subjects 417 individuals (42.12%).

Most of the reason teenagers have sex is due to environmental influences, vcd, books and pornographic movies that is: the male subjects as many as 389 people (29.07%), whereas in female subjects 444 individuals (31.11%). The reason for the progress of time and let slang, male subjects 113 people (8.44%), in female subjects 99 people (6.94%).

Sex education for teens

Today, Indonesia is experiencing an intense period of development, both in terms of economic development and socio-cultural development. One aspect of social change evident in Indonesia is related to sex. Teenagers and young people are changing their attitudes, ideas and behaviour in relation to sex. Amongst these groups, higher rates of pre-marital and high-risk sexual behaviour are being recorded by various NGO’s working in the area of reproductive health. A number of associated social problems have emerged such as high rates of unplanned teen pregnancy, high rates of transmission of Sexually Transmitted Infections including HIV/AIDS, and a general lack of understanding regarding sex. These aspects reveal a lack of an adequate Sexual and Reproductive Health Education program institutionalised across schools of Indonesia.
This Field Study focuses on the school environment as one institution in society that has the opportunity to reach a large proportion of Indonesia’s youth. While a significant number of Indonesia’s youth lie outside the reach of educational bodies (either in the workforce or on the streets), schools have a great role to play in protecting today’s youth – with knowledge. However, it is evident that few schools are taking advantage of this opportunity and most are providing limited Sexual and Reproductive Health Education. With little support or guidance from the government, schools provide
what information they see fit, largely influenced by the religious and societal norms surrounding the school. As a result, Sex Education in Indonesia is limited, with a focus on the biological side of reproductive health, and Abstinence-Only focused lessons.
The process of researching this field study revealed a number of approaches to Sex Education. In some schools, Sexual and Reproductive Health Education was quite limited, while others utilised community resources such as the services of NGO’s to provide a fuller and more rounded program to students. Students today are, in general, supportive of Sex Education. While significantly more Westernised than their parent’s generation, Indonesian youth of today still hold religious values quite highly. In relation to Sexual and Reproductive Health, the students researched in this field study were keen to have more access to knowledge, provided by schools as a trusted source of information and provided in such a way as to be in harmony with their religious values. If such information was unavailable in schools, youth were likely to go to the mass media (especially the internet and various popular pornographic materials) for such information. The topic of sex in general is still regarded as somewhat taboo in Indonesia, and is not generally discussed in clear terms. This is an attitude that is changing with time. However, it did hamper my efforts to research this field, as respondents were often nervous or uncomfortable discussing a sex-related topic. Language and other cultural barriers provided challenges to the research of this very brief account of Sex Education in Yogyakarta.

Methods in schools to educate the students pre-school and kindergarten about sex education, it can be done by:

* 1 year
Introduce children to the parts of his body sendiri.Di this age, children need to be introduced to members of the body. Introduce the name of the body, as well as differences and functions, while you're bathing or shower with the children. You can also use books and props, human doll for example. Do not forget to remain calm when you have to be naked in front of the child while bathing or changing clothes.

* 2 years
Can recognize and name parts of the body At the age of 2 years, children generally can mention parts of his body smoothly, such as eyes, nose, ears, hands, and feet. To make it more familiar with other body parts, you can also make this activity more fun. Pack in the form of the game. Indicate the body (you just say it anyway), such as ear, then invite your child to be holding his ears. So also in other body parts you mentioned.

* 3 years
Know the difference if your child is able to recognize his own body parts, it's time to introduce the gender differences. Introduce the two categories of male and female sexes. Explain also male genitalia is a penis and women is the vagina, as well as differences of form and function. By introducing the parts of the body and the difference, the child will have a favorable view of the body.

* 4 years
Keeping yourself When children are getting bigger, teach that part of her genitals-not-be held by any person, except by the mother (while bathing) and doctors (when I'm sick). They must immediately report directly to parents or teachers when there are other people who touched her private parts. Aside from being a form of sex education to keep the private parts of her body, it can make a child protected from sexual violence.

* 5 years
Orderly and Caring Ourselves Along with the development of age, at this stage the child get used to urinating in the right place. Familiarize him urinate in the toilet, not in trees, bushes, or public places that are open. To change her clothes as well get used to looking for a room or toilet and not do it in public. Teach your children and get used to clean the genitals properly, especially after bladder / bowel movements. Do not forget to teach him always wash hands after bladder / bowel movement, and explain that the germs can enter through the vagina / penis and anal.
